Finally! Aston Martin will introduce the V12 Vantage to North America. It is about time.

Boasting a V12 good for 510-ponies and 420 lb-ft of torque, this uprated Vantage is sure to please. Already being the smaller brother to the DB9 and DBS, the Vantage is acclaimed for its comparative nimbleness and smaller size.

So, it appears that Aston has struck gold. Again.

Aston Martin's press release follows:

Irvine, 3rd June 2010 -- Aston Martin confirms pricing in the Americas for the eagerly
awaited V12 Vantage, Aston Martin’s most exhilarating sports car. The V12 Vantage
will start from $179,995, with the Carbon Black Special Edition priced at $194,995.
Based on the hugely successful V8 Vantage, the V12 Vantage features a 6.0 litre
V12 engine producing 510 bhp, and 420 lb ft (570 Nm) of torque with a top speed of
190 mph and a 0-60 mph time of 4.1 seconds.

Offered with a six-speed manual transmission, the V12 Vantage is first and foremost
a driver’s car, inviting and rewarding the driver’s full involvement. Aston Martin’s most
powerful engine has been combined with its most agile model, complete with carbon
ceramic brakes and revised suspension to create a truly potent and dynamic sports
car.

The Carbon Black Special Edition adds a typically understated flair to V12 Vantage.
On the exterior, the car features a bespoke Carbon Black metallic paint with a subtle
metallic twist to create a deep, rich patina; painstakingly created through a handpainting
process taking 50 man-hours. The iconic Aston Martin side strake has been
fashioned from carbon fibre backed by a black mesh and complimented with gloss
black, 10-spoke diamond-turned alloy wheels. A bright finished grill and front parking
sensors (normally an option) complete the exterior detailing.

Inside, owners are greeted by swathes of Obsidian Black leather highlighted with a
contrast silver coarse stitch hand-stitched by Aston Martin craftspeople. Also featured
are a Piano Black facia trim, center stack and center console, anodised black tread
plates and unique sill plaques build on the carbon theme. The normally optional
Aston Martin 700w Premium Audio System is delivered as standard.

The V12 Vantage is hand-built at Aston Martin’s global headquarters in Gaydon, UK,
joining the DBS, DB9 and V8 Vantage model lines which are also built in the state-ofthe-
art production facility combining hi-tech manufacturing processes with traditional
hand-craftsmanship.

The V12 Vantage is available to order now from the Aston Martin dealer network
across the Americas. Customer deliveries will commence in quarter four 2010.
